What is a 20 Foot Container?
A 20-foot container, frequently referred to as a TEU (Twenty-foot Equivalent Unit), is a standard shipping container utilized for transferring goods across the world. Its dimensions make it flexible for various kinds of cargo, including palletized products, cars, equipment, and raw products.
Specifications of a 20 Foot Container
The following table describes the essential specifications of a standard [20 foot container size](https://git.apextoaster.com/20-foot-container1830)-foot container:
DimensionMeasurementExternal Length20 ft (6.058 m)External Width8 ft (2.438 m)External Height8.5 ft (2.591 m)Internal Length19.4 ft (5.898 m)Internal Width7.7 ft (2.352 m)Internal Height7.9 ft (2.385 m)Maximum Gross Weight24,000 kg (52,910 lbs)Tare Weight2,300 kg (5,071 pounds)Payload Capacity21,700 kg (47,851 lbs)Volume33.1 cubic metersStyle Variants

What can fit inside a 20-foot container?
A 20-foot container can normally hold about 10-11 basic pallets or up to 21,700 kg of cargo depending on the kind of products being delivered.
2. Just how much does a 20-foot container weigh?
The tare weight of a basic 20-foot container is around 2,300 kg (5,071 lbs).
3. Are 20-foot containers appropriate for moving houses?
Yes, they offer an exceptional option for transferring a little home's worth of valuables due to their size.
4. How do I secure cargo in a 20-foot container?
Cargo ought to be secured using straps, dunnage, and pallets to prevent motion during transportation and guarantee safe shipment.
